Content processor

Content processors are sometimes confused with network processors that inspect the packet payload of an IP packet travelling through a computer network. These components allow for the design and deployment of next-generation networking systems that can make packet or message processing decisions based on an awareness of the packet or message content. The work of Content Processors is often termed Content Processing or Deep Packet Inspection, DPI, though some people feel that the expression DPI is too limiting as many Content Processors can modify and re-write content on the fly - therefore they can do much more than just inspect which implies a sort of monitoring only function.
